The European Handball Federation on Tuesday made new decisions for the continental championships of young age groups that were postponed to January next year. The decision also has an impact on the Kosovo National Teams.
Thus, the U20 European Championship of Division B, in which Kosovo was supposed to appear, has been completely cancelled. The European U20 should have been held in January in Latvia. Initially, the deadline was for summer 2020, but then it was postponed to January 2021, due to the situation created with the coronavirus. Now the EHF has completely canceled this European, same as other championships of this age group.
As for the U18 age group, the European Division B has not been canceled but has been postponed. The event scheduled to be held in January 2021 in Montenegro has been postponed to August next year. The European will now be held in Latvia, while Kosovo will participate.
Consequently, participation in the tournament in Bulgaria from November 12 to 15 has been cancelled. Other activities are planned for the U18 National Team during the next year.
